What is CBD oil?

CBD oil is made from cannabidiol, the non-psychoactive, powerfully medicinal chemical in weed. Pure CBD oil is made without THC, the psychoactive compound that gets you high. CBD oil is a great place to start for discovering the health benefits of cannabis without getting stoned.

CBD oil works by activating receptors in the body’s endocannabinoid system. These are linked to everything from hormone regulation and mood to appetite, sleep, memory, and cognition. Therefore, many common symptoms of illnesses are minimized by CBD.

Pure CBD is available in many forms. Concentrates can be added to food or directly ingested, pills can be taken daily, and topical salves can target pain points. Here are a few of the reasons why many patients love CBD oil. 

CBD oil for pain and inflammation

CBD is most commonly used as a natural form of pain and inflammation relief. In a 2012 study in the Journal of Experimental Medicine, CBD was found to significantly suppress chronic inflammatory and neuropathic pain in lab rats without a tolerance build-up. Cannabinoids also inhibit neuronal transmission in pain pathways, which is why many patients use CBD oil for the pain of headaches, arthritis, multiple sclerosis, and other chronic illnesses.

Inflammation can lead to a heap of illnesses including cancer, stroke, diabetes, heart disease, and Alzheimer’s. It may seem hopelessly difficult to manage inflammation yourself, but CBD makes a great assistant. 

CBD oil for stress and anxiety

40 million adults in the United States suffer from an anxiety disorder, which also makes it challenging to control stress. Chronic stress can contribute to many different problems in the body, most of all inflammation. Several studies have shown favorable results for patients suffering from generalized social anxiety disorder who opted for CBD as a form of treatment.

CBD to reduce medication dependency

Many patients who try CBD are using it for symptoms that are reduced by Tylenol, Ibuprofen, Aleve, and especially relevant – opioids. When taken for long periods of time these medicines can lead to addiction, dependency, and stomach issues.

For a study published by the Brightfield Group and HelloMD, 2,400 HelloMD members were questioned about their CBD usage. 42% of those surveyed claimed to have replaced traditional medicines with cannabis due to the benefits of CBD.

Perhaps the even larger study to note on CBD and drug use is a report on recreational weed and opioids published in Drug and Alcohol Dependence. According to the study, states with recreational cannabis saw opioid-related hospitalizations drop an average of 23%. Overdose hospitalizations also dropped an average of 13%. These laws have even allowed some rehab facilities to use cannabis as a tapering method for addicts suffering from withdrawal. Rather than act as a gateway drug, cannabis is used to help addicts reach the other side.
